So verdict is in... 1 male svart, 2 female svart, one female svart/cemani cross, 3 Male cemani, 3 female cemani. Thank you all for your help. Happy the breed in them was caught sooner then later. I was close to just calling them all svart.
 
Last edited:
Also I was told at this age only the cemani will have a purple tint in sun light. The svart will show the green more in the back. Also all the svart will have a dark green tint in the mouth showing around week 9-10 were as the cemani will be black. Also while stretching the cemani will look like the svart but over all the svart will have a bit of a longer neck and will have a grey look to the fluff that has yet changed into feathers.
